On July 24th, the court imposed a temporary move preventing MPs from taking steps for the constitutionalisation of the Parliament until August 8th, when the ban expires and a new decision is expected.

Prime Minister Albin Kurti's left-minded Vetevendosje party won 48 seats in the February elections, but failed to secure the majority in the 120-seat Assembly.

Since the constitutional hearing on 15 April, dozens of rounds of voting have been held without success. The incumbent prime minister and his party are still trying to avoid holding early elections.

Of course, we are not interested in new elections, if the decision is made to go to new elections, then we will respect it and move on with it. The Constitutional Court sees this as the only way to get out of this”, told aboutEuronews Saranda Boguyevci, deputy of Vetevendosje.

The crisis lies in voting procedures: Vetevendosje proposes secret vote, while the opposition calls for an open vote, as the Constitution predicts.

The Democratic Party of Kosovo (PDK), the Democratic League of Kosovo (LDK) and President Vjosa Osmani have demanded a separate interpretation by the Constitutional Court, as its 26 June ruling failed to resolve the stalemate.

According to MP Daut Haradinaj from the Alliance for the Future of Kosovo (AAK), the election of Justice Minister Albula Haxhiu as Speaker of the Parliament is another key point in the severe clash between Kurti and the opposition.

Vetevendosje proposed the secret vote as a way to convince some opposition deputies to vote for its candidate without facing penalties from their party.

However, opposition parties rejected this proposal as unconstitutional, bringing the issue to the Constitutional Court as the possible arbitrator. But opposition MPs remained convinced that the crisis could not be resolved without new elections.

The only requirement was for the vote to be open and the candidate for chairman of the Parliament to be changed. I see we're going to the election very soon,” Haradinaj said.

Kosovo's “institutions are hostage to Albin Kurti's stubbornness. We have offered our compromises, but unfortunately, the leader of the ruling party rejects any ideas of co-operation,” said PDK deputy Vlora Citaku, broadcast the Express.

Kosovo and its future are far more important than Albin Kurti's political career and Albulen Haxhiu,”, it ended.

On the other hand, Vetevendosje deputies believe that a Constitutional Court ruling by 2014 has set a precedent that gives the winning party the right to propose and elect the Speaker of the Parliament.

According to them, opposition demands for constitutional implementation are only an excuse to prevent the formation of a new government led by Kurti.

“They rejected the coalition, yes. But in my opinion, they didn't have a valid reason why they refused, if we speak for the good of the country,” concluded Bogujevci. /Periscopi/
